Output 184bd7fab36a26c137e4b50a396f0bb83d9fcab6e5bef16d007060a85e54cb39:2

value
25640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522551fa778af2a1348da45cd1789fe843969582 OP_EQUAL
address
39BN3L2BWWSuJQaEGieyr492vhoo2o4E8Y
transaction
184bd7fab36a26c137e4b50a396f0bb83d9fcab6e5bef16d007060a85e54cb39